I think I got it but I'm not sure. The progress buttons uses images and not text like the original touch dialer. All i did was change some things in the registry to remove the text but you can always add them again but it will look nasty because it will be covering the graphics. The point is that i chose to use image instead and not text. The touch dialer does not have dedicated images for all (up/down) states in the progress page. A dialer that does is the HTC Dialer but that is a GSM dialer. I'm working on integrating those features onto this dialer that way we can have a cleaner looking dialer with only images and no text. |
